直播开发的进阶操作:一对一直播交友源码开发的几大核心环节

原标题:直播开发的进阶操作:一对一直播交友源码开发的几大核心环节

直播平台内容同质化现象严重,给了一对一直播交友平台迅速发展的机会,以陌陌为首的“直播+社交”平台异军突起,逐渐掌控了直播市场80%的中长尾用户流量。那么,对于一对一直播交友源码开发来讲,有哪些关键步骤呢?

首先是一对一直播交友源码功能确定

1.视频直播功能,这是一款视频直播App最核心的功能,支持RTMP/HLS等推流协议,使画面传输流畅、清晰;

2.聊天功能,用户之间的互动聊天,包括文字和表情,当然除了视频直播间内的互动聊天,还应该有语音聊天功能;

3.互动功能,用户与主播间的互动,点亮、送礼、互动小游戏等等;

4.支付&提现功能,用户用现金购买礼物送给心仪的主播,主播收到礼物后可再兑换成现金取出;

5.视频回放功能,在直播的过程中同时录像,使得没看到直播的粉丝也有机会再看;

6.分享功能,将房间号分享到微信、微博、QQ等;

7.除了以上这些基础功能外,针对不同用户需求的频道分类设置,才是整个一对一直播交友源码开发的灵魂,专业化的直播服务势必要将各种各样的功能融入到程序中,比如音乐电台、在线下单系统开发(用于各类付费服务板块)、狼人杀游戏等功能。

其次是寻找合适的云服务SDK进行接入

在APICloud的聚合API中可以轻易找到绝大多数的功能模块,挑选合适的模块封装到自己的App中。常见的基础SDK模块有:

1.聊天文本/表情输入有chatbox,UIChatbox等模块;

2.及时通讯(互动功能):融云,环信等模块,也可以自己通过socketManager自己封装协议实现;

3.支付提现:支付宝、ping++、微信支付、银联支付、现在支付等模块;

4.视频回放:视频回放功能的实现其实是录像+存储到服务器中,因此使用APICloud的数据云功能即可实现;

5.直播/主播分享:微信、新浪微博、QQ等平台分享模块。

如果要使得一对一直播交友平台有着运营级别的产品体验,那么动态贴纸SDK、语音聊天SDK、语音识别SDK等专业SDK供应商也是需要耗费很大的精力去考察一番的。

最后完成一对一直播交友APP开发的五个核心步骤

挑选完我们所需的所有模块后,通过核心的五个步骤来实现APP开发。

1.App框架搭建,在APICloud Studio中直接创建应用框架,有三个常用页面框架备选;

2.积木式拼装,将所有你挑选好的模块,用Java编写页面及模块调用,运用HTML5+CSS3搭建应用的界面UI,完成App编码全过程;

3.真机调试,通过模拟器和真机调试功能进行App优化,一键点击即可在iOS和Androi手机中进行App优化;

4.云编译,在APICloud官网上传App的icon、启动页和证书,一键“云编译”即可同时生成iOS和Android的原生安装包;

5.云修复,使用云修复快速迭代,随时发布新版本、新功能,无需提交新的安装包。

相对而言,一对一直播交友源码的开发难度会稍大一些,由于中长尾用户的产品体验需求不同,导致系统开发功能模块较多,很多单一功能的开发都会耗费很高的开发成本。在发完成后在系统本身的兼容性及并发量测试上更会耗费大量的人工成本和时间成本。因此,在确定一对一直播交友平台功能需求后,一定要委托专业的软件开发商进行开发。

网络赚钱方法大全版权所有